> I happened to stumble over
> http://wiki.openstreetmap.org/wiki/Tag:amenity%3Dcommunity_centre
> The definition restricts usage with this sentence "The Community
> Centre is owned and provided by the local government."
>
> The linked wikipedia article
> http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Community_centre doesn't for good
> reasons: it mentions a lot of those facilities run by religious
> communities, which are in most countries not "the local government".
> There is also the possibility that a foundation or a political party
> run a centre like this.
>
> I find the restriction to governmental institutions somewhat
> unnecessary. What about changing this? We could still encourage the
> use of an operator tag to clarify who runs the thing.
